It can do whatever you ask, and if you are passionate about the famous Harry Potter wizarding saga, this article is going to enchant you, as we are going to teach you how to control your mobile using some of the most famous spells. It sounds geekier than it is, really.

- Lumos: the flashlight will turn on.
- Nox: the flashlight will turn off.
- Mute: the phone will be muted.
Unfortunately, these are the only three spells that are available. It would be great to say “Avada Kedavra” and for the phone to turn off or “Cruciatus” to flood a WhatsApp chat and drive its participants crazy, although it is not possible – unfortunately -.
